DragonFlyBSD 4.8
Intel Core i7-6800K testing on DragonFly via the Phoronix Test Suite.
DragonFlyBSD 4.8
Processor: Intel Core i7-6800K @ 3.40GHz (12 Cores), Motherboard: MSI MS-7A54 1.0, Memory: 16384MB, Disk: SATA Samsung SSD 850 EMT0 + SATA TOSHIBA-TR150 SAFZ + SATA TOSHIBA-TR150 SAFZ + SATA TOSHIBA-TR150 SAFZ + SATA TOSHIBA-TR150 SAFZ, Network: Intel PRO/1000 Connection PCH_I218_LM2 7.4.2
OS: DragonFly, Kernel: 4.8-RELEASE (x86_64), Compiler: GCC 5.4.1, File-System: hammer
System Notes: Python 2.7.13.

PostMark
This is a test of NetApp's PostMark benchmark designed to simulate small-file testing similar to the tasks endured by web and mail servers. This test profile will set PostMark to perform 25,000 transactions with 500 files simultaneously with the file sizes ranging between 5 and 512 kilobytes.
